PMC COVID-19 Forecasting Model, Sept 9, 2024 🧵1/7 Nationally, we appear to have passed the peak of our late-summer wave, and it's not pretty. At peak: 🔹>1.3 million daily infections 🔹2.8% (1 in 36) actively infectious 🔹Transmission higher than 90.5% of the pandemic We are

PMC COVID-19 Forecasting Model, Sept 9, 2024 
🧵1/7

Nationally, we appear to have passed the peak of our late-summer wave, and it's not pretty.

At peak:
🔹>1.3 million daily infections
🔹2.8% (1 in 36) actively infectious
🔹Transmission higher than 90.5% of the pandemic

3/ Dyssynergic defecation Is by far the most common abnormality I see in POTS Essentially when the pt goes to defecate, instead of relaxing the EAS they do the opposite and contract the EAS. The harder the motion the more the pt noticed this as more effort is required.
